S.F. boy, 15, charged in friend's killing

This just gets sadder and sadder.

From SFGate,
A 15-year-old San Francisco boy was charged with murder and attempted arson Tuesday in connection with the shooting death of a 16-year-old friend whose body was found with a bag over his head on a gasoline-soaked floor, authorities said.

The boy has been charged as a juvenile, meaning he would face a maximum confinement until age 25 if convicted of the killing early Sunday of Andy Zeng, a student at Thurgood Marshall Academic High School. The youth's name has not been released because he is a minor.

The suspect told police that the shooting was an accident that happened as he and Zeng were playing with a gun on the ground floor of a two-story duplex in Silver Terrace, investigators said.
